New Policy: Enter Tibet from Nepal with a Chinese Tourist Visa - No Group Visa Required
ContentGood news comes that foreign friends can enter Tibet from Nepal with Chinese Tourist Visa (L-Visa) instead of Chinese Group Visa. This adjustment offers greater convenience and flexibility for international travelers visiting Tibet.Tibet Horizon clients holding their Chinese Tourist Visa have entered Tibet from Nepal successfully, namely, Ms.Sve*** from Russia flew from Kathmandu to Lhasa on Apr.14 and Mr.Jac*** from the USA traveled overland from Nepal to Tibet via Gyirong Port on May.22, 2025.
Group Visa Requirement Was a Long-Time Barrier
For a long time, travelers who enter Tibet from Nepal shall apply for Chinese Group Visa in Kathmandu with unified entry arrangements, which caused significant inconvenience for travelers:
Complicated procedures: To obtain a group visa, a Tibetan travel agency like Tibet Horizon shall issue an invitation letter first and then a Nepalese travel agency would apply on behalf of the group of four travelers.
Time constraints: The processing time for the group visa is relatively long, taking at least three working days, and you must arrive at Kathmandu in advance.
Lack of flexibility: Travelers holding a group visa must enter and exit Tibet with the group, leaving no room for flexible travel plans.
New Policy Highlights
According to the latest information obtained from our partner travel agencies in Nepal, the newly implemented regulations mainly include:
1. With a valid Chinese Tourist Visa (L-Visa), travelers can now enter Tibet from Nepal via Gyirong Port or
Lhasa Gonggar Airport normally.
2. No need to apply for a group visa through the Chinese Embassy in Kathmandu.
This change will greatly simplify the entry process for travelers, save both time and costs, and offer travel agencies greater flexibility in planning.
Chinese L-VisaNo Group Visa Needed, But Tibet Permits Required
Although Chinese Tourist Visa can now be used to enter Tibet from Kathmandu, please note the following:
1. You need to obtain a Tibet Travel Permit in advance, which is mandatory for all foreign travelers visiting Tibet and can only be applied by a licensed Tibetan travel agency like Tibet Horizon. It’s recommended to book your Tibet Tour at least one month ahead and we will assist you with the permit for free.
2. For certain areas such as Ngari, Mt. Kailash, Mt. Everest, and Shigatse, an additional Aliens’ Travel Permit is required. During the trip, our guide will accompany you to obtain this permit, so there’s no need to worry about the permit process.
3. Please make sure your passport and visa are valid for the whole trip. Bring your original passport and visa when entering. Our guide will meet you at the Lhasa Airport or Gyirong Port.
